Mark Aloysius PITT DCM

PITT, Mark Aloysius

Service Numbers: 615, V148300
Enlisted: 24 July 1915
Last Rank: Lieutenant
Last Unit: 32nd Infantry Battalion
Born: MALVERN, VIC, 17 March 1894
Occupation: Station Hand, Soldier, District Officer - Papua New Guinea
Died: Madang, Papua New Guinea, 19 January 1951, aged 56 years, cause of death not yet discovered

World War 1 Service

24 Jul 1915: Enlisted AIF WW1, Private, 615, 29th Infantry Battalion
10 Nov 1915: Embarked AIF WW1, Private, 615, 29th Infantry Battalion, --- :embarkation_roll: roll_number: '16' embarkation_place: Melbourne embarkation_ship: HMAT Ascanius embarkation_ship_number: A11 public_note: ''
8 Mar 1917: Promoted AIF WW1, Corporal
26 Mar 1917: Promoted AIF WW1, Sergeant
29 Sep 1918: Wounded AIF WW1, Sergeant
12 Oct 1918: Transferred AIF WW1, Sergeant, 32nd Infantry Battalion
14 Mar 1919: Honoured Distinguished Conduct Medal, Gazetted 14/3/1919.
28 Jul 1919: Discharged AIF WW1, Sergeant, 32nd Infantry Battalion

World War 2 Service

15 Jun 1942: Enlisted V148300
29 Nov 1945: Discharged Australian Military Forces (WW2) , Lieutenant, V148300
